FRANKLIN SPRINGS, Ga. –
Cyrus Henderson,
Garvin Johnson, and
Cole Morris recorded four goals apiece in today's Conference Carolinas men's lacrosse game at Emmanuel. The Lions defeated Lees-McRae, 19-15, in Franklin Springs.
THE BASICS
FINAL SCORE: Lees-McRae – 15; Emmanuel (Ga.) – 19
LOCATION: Stephens Field – Franklin Springs, Georgia
RECORDS: Lees-McRae (3-7/1-3), Emmanuel (7-4/2-2
HOW IT HAPPENED:
- Emmanuel ended the first quarter on a 3-0 scoring run and led 7-3 after the first 15 minutes. The Lions added to their first half lead and led 10-5 at halftime.
- Johnson scored the opening goal of the second half, but Emmanuel led 17-8 after 30 minutes of action.
- Lees-McRae recorded seven goals in the final quarter, but Emmanuel picked up the 19-15 win on Stephens Field today.
- Johnson led the Bobcats with four goals, 10 ground balls, and went 14-16 from the face-off dot. Morris followed with four goals and C. Henderson joined them with four goals on the day.
- Dryden Murrell went 11-19 from the face-off and picked up seven ground balls for Lees-McRae. Eddie Patterson made 10 saves in goal for the Bobcats.
